Stadium History
Levi's Stadium in Santa Clara, California, opened in 2014 as the new home of the San Francisco 49ers. The stadium was the first NFL venue to achieve LEED Gold certification for sustainable design. It has hosted Super Bowl 50 (2016), the College Football Playoff National Championship (2019), and numerous concerts. The stadium is located in the heart of Silicon Valley.
How to Get There
Located in Santa Clara, the stadium is accessible by Caltrain and VTA light rail (Great America station). The venue is 5 minutes from San Jose Mineta International Airport and 35 minutes from San Francisco International Airport. The stadium has been praised for its fan-friendly technology and amenities.
